Welcome to the Lintera localization pipeline. The extract-strings script scans the web and mobile repos nightly, pulls translatable strings into the catalog, and opens a PR against the glossary branch. When reviewing these PRs, check that placeholder tokens survive extraction intact and that no source comments leak into translator notes. The script runs under the CI service account, and its output bundle must be signed before upload. The key used for signing is below.

release key, fajef-kajeg: bky19_LdLu6Ne6FLi8he2c24d

**Action Item 7: Revamp the password reset flow.** During the Fernhollow outage we learned our reset emails queued behind marketing blasts — yikes. Owner: the Identity squad. Scope: move reset sends to the priority lane, add a 15-minute token expiry, and kill the legacy fallback endpoint that nobody remembers writing. New folks, this is a great starter project since the code is small and well-tested. Design notes and the rollout checklist are on the internal planning page.

wiki page, yagef-fahaf: https://grafana.ferracorp.corp/spaces/view/projects/board/job/board/issue/dddcb27874b55298d2204852

Runbook: GarageGlance occupancy feed

If the Harborview Deck occupancy feed goes stale (no updates for 5+ minutes), first check the sensor gateway health page. Green but stale usually means the aggregator queue is backed up; restart the aggregator via the ops console and counts should recover within two minutes. If spots show negative numbers, force a full recount from the camera snapshots. When escalating to engineering, include the trace token shown below.

session token of yawif-kahof = htk9_dd6996ed6

**Q: The queue-depth autoscaler stopped scaling — what now?**

Check the Driftmark controller pod first. If depth exceeds 10k and no scale event fires, the autoscaler's state store is likely corrupt. Restore it from the hourly snapshot; don't tweak thresholds mid-incident. Snapshot restores require unlocking the Harrowell state vault, which accepts the recovery phrase below.

unlock words, yaguf-fajep: praiel-kasdor-druax-wenix-fenok-juldor-eliox-zordor-novath-quenir